Course Information


Keyboarding & Computer Literacy


Keyboarding is a necessary skill for everyone to survive in today's "computerized" society; therefore, it is required for all WMMS students. If you are entering West Millbrook as a sixth grader, you will be automatically signed up to take keyboarding as one of your two semester electives. If you are enrolling in a year-long elective such as band, orchestra, or curriculum assistance, you will take a shortened course during the half period immediately before or after lunch. In keyboarding you'll learn much more than touch-typing and technique, you'll also learn about basic computer components and how a computer works, along with a quick introduction to database and spreadsheet software. If you have had computer experience with word processing and keyboarding in elementary school, you will soon discover that there is much more to learn. You'll discover an assortment of new word processing tips and tricks that you can use for the rest of your life!


Business Computer Technology I

Seventh and eighth grade students at West Millbrook know how often the core teachers assign computer related projects. This course will give you a huge advantage when these projects are received! Business Computer Technology, Level I is designed to build upon the things you learned in Keyboarding/Computer Literacy. You'll get lots of new software experience as you work with desktop publishing, spreadsheets, database, presentation, and telecommunication applications. An added benefit for choosing this class is that it will prepare you for the 8th Grade Computer Skills Test! (see link above left).


Business Computer Technology II

If you earn an "A" or "B" in Business Computer Technology, Level 1, this elective is for you! It is perfect for creative students who love working with computer applications and are interested in exploring computer related careers. In this course, the skills you learned in BCT, Level 1 will be reinforced and expanded. BCT, Level 2 will help you become more independent as you work with computers at school and home. Throughout the semester you will create an imaginary business. Using desktop publishing, spreadsheets, database management, multimedia presentations, and web design software, you will design documents for that business. Through your imaginary business, you will also learn basic entrepreneurial skills, along with financial and marketing concepts. In this class, you will work on some assignments with a classroom team, while many projects are done independently. We are hoping to take a field trip to IBM at some point during the semester. There you will meet with computer professionals and see them at work!
